ALPHA SERIES HARDBOUND SKETCHBOOKS
Stillman & Birn Alpha Series Hardbound Sketchbooks, 150 gsm (Heavyweight), white paper, medium grain surface (light tooth). Suitable for dry media, light wash and ink. Example of recommended usage: working in pencil or ink mixed with watercolor. Acid-free, chloride-free, lignin-free.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use watercolor in this sketchbook?
Yes. The 150gsm paper is heavyweight enough to handle light washes and mixed media on both sides of the page. It's designed for combining dry media like pencil or ink with watercolor, though heavy watercolor may cause some buckling.
What is the paper surface like?
The paper has a medium grain surface with light tooth, ideal for dry media like pencil and charcoal while still accepting ink and light wet media.
Will this work with fountain pens?
Yes, the heavyweight 150gsm paper is suitable for fountain pen and ink work without excessive bleed-through.
Can I erase in this sketchbook?
Yes. The paper is erasable and durable enough to withstand multiple erasures without damage.
What is the binding and durability like?
The sketchbook features a thick hardbound cover with premium U.S. sewn binding, designed to hold up to regular heavy use and layered artwork.
Is the paper acid-free and archival-safe?
Yes. The paper is acid-free, chloride-free, and lignin-free, making it suitable for archival artwork.
